FLUX.1 [Inpainting with lora] is an AI-powered image editing tool designed to generate and modify images through inpainting. Using prompts and masks, it reconstructs or fills specific parts of an image, allowing users to retouch, restore, or create new visuals. Built with LoRA (Low-Rank Adaptation) technology, FLUX.1 efficiently handles complex image processing tasks while maintaining high-quality outputs.
• Mask-based inpainting: Define areas to edit using masks for precise control.
• Prompt-driven generation: Use text prompts to guide the inpainting process.
• LoRA optimization: Leverages LoRA technology for efficient and accurate image processing.
• Support for multiple image formats: Works with popular formats including PNG, JPG, and more.
• User-friendly interface: Designed for both beginners and professionals to streamline workflows.
What is LoRA technology?
LoRA (Low-Rank Adaptation) is a technique that enables efficient fine-tuning of large AI models, making them faster and more accessible without sacrificing quality.
Can I use FLUX.1 for non-inpainting tasks?
FLUX.1 is primarily designed for inpainting tasks, but its capabilities can be extended to other forms of image generation and editing depending on the prompts and masks used.
How do I create an effective mask for inpainting?
For best results, create a mask that clearly defines the area you want to edit. Use sharp, well-defined boundaries and ensure the mask aligns with your intended edits.
